Images of the Waitemata- Millennium Cup another great day's racing
by Paul Gilbert on 16 Feb 2013
2013 Millennium Cup - Day 2, Waitemata Harbour, Auckland Paul Gilbert .
http://www.aquapx.com
Paul Gilbert from AquaPx was on hand to capture the action in another great days racing in the Millennium Cup, as the super yachts powered up the harbour to the finish line.
